Facts about Voltage-dependent calcium channel gamma-8 subunit.
Promotes their targeting to the cell membrane and synapses and modulates their gating properties by slowing their rates of activation, deactivation and desensitization and by mediating their resensitization. Does not reveal subunit-specific AMPA receptor regulation and regulates all AMPAR subunits.
